NINNA BERGER
Visual artist. Born 1980 in Svedala, Sweden. Lives and works in Malmö and in Stockholm.
Ninna Beger´s practice is material-based and she thinks of her works as collages — or as a form of visual poetry. Through craft-based processes, teh artist processes textiles, paper, and organic materials with chemistry, water, and pigments in an attempt to give form to the immaterial.
Her work is grounded in a humility toward the associative capacities of the senses and toward the ways materials relate to the body as a carrier of memory. In the process, materials act as mediators between the tactile and the perceptual — between what can be touched and what can only be sensed.
Ninna Berger is interested in the potential of materiality to open spaces for subjective interpretation. Through surfaces, textures, and layers of pigment, she explores how material qualities can evoke memories, atmospheres, and personal experiences in the viewer.
The artist is driven by a sense of wonder at the inherent expressiveness of materials and their ability to suggest something beyond the immediately visible.
Ninna Berger holds a MFA from Konstfack University College of Arts and Crafts in Stockholm.
